      Overall a sensible move by Yamaha, the Alba wasnt moving on its own so they sprinkled some HH magic on it and came up with the YBR 110. For all those who are going to crib about Yamaha going down the HH route, the article clearly states they are targetting the rural market. And as well as the R15 & FZ (+ variants) are selling, they still need volumes from the lower end bikes.

                        Japanese two-wheeler major Yamaha on Tuesday launched its new commuter segment motorcycle -YBR 110, in the Indian market, priced at Rs 41,000 (ex-showroom, Delhi).
                        The 4-stroke YBR 110 comes with a 106 cc engine and has 4-speed gearbox, it added.
